David Einhorn's investment firm, DME Capital, has purchased 1.42 million shares of PayPal Holdings Inc. (NASDAQ: PYPL), representing a $61.5 million stake. The move signals Einhorn's conviction in PayPal's financial trajectory, citing improvements in earnings, cash flow, and the company's overall outlook as reasons for the investment. This substantial bet by a prominent value investor suggests PayPal may be presenting a compelling buying opportunity for those seeking undervalued assets in the payment processing sector.
